Output ec129c2b02ff8d61707abdd513218ca4ebe013efbc9ed7a6ae3dea97d1879e58:0

value
8236602
script pubkey
OP_0 OP_PUSHBYTES_20 5c0ae65dac7609cf9f956e3faf42a33b7f00cc89
address
bc1qts9wvhdvwcyul8u4dcl67s4r8dlspnyfud3dp6
transaction
ec129c2b02ff8d61707abdd513218ca4ebe013efbc9ed7a6ae3dea97d1879e58
confirmations
153285
spent
true